Size: a a a

Clojure — русскоговорящее сообщество

2020 November 08

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Точно так же во втором примере - ты вставляешь пробел, удаляешь проблел и xxxx остается внутри defn к которому оно не имеет отношения
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
😊
надеюсь, спрашивающему хватило примеров
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
В паредит и Ко хотя бы есть гарантия что у тебя не произойдет какая-то ебулда за пределами экрана пока ты просто вставляешь пробельчики
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
У них у всех майндсет такой что структуру надо жетско поддерживать и не менять пока пользователь не нажмет хоткей меняющий структуру
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Кстати в smartparens есть sp-indent-adjust-sexp который делает ровно то же самое что и паринфер
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Только не ломая ничего 🙂
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
Anton Chikin
я про то что я вставил скобки, удалил скобки и получил не то что было до этой операции
я, кстати, на практике не помню, чтобы с таким столкнулся
видимо, если мне нужно писать новую форму, то всегда начинаю с новой скобочки 😊
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Sergey Trofimov
я, кстати, на практике не помню, чтобы с таким столкнулся
видимо, если мне нужно писать новую форму, то всегда начинаю с новой скобочки 😊
Это при копипасте стреляет часто
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Я просто механизм показал
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
А если скажем взять кусок одной формы и пытаться его вставить в другую - там мясо все время
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
Anton Chikin
Это при копипасте стреляет часто
при копипасте стреляет в зависимости от того, как выровнен вставляемый код 😊
я вообще только из-за паринфера научился код не строками копировать, а формами, выделяя из через expand region
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
Sergey Trofimov
при копипасте стреляет в зависимости от того, как выровнен вставляемый код 😊
я вообще только из-за паринфера научился код не строками копировать, а формами, выделяя из через expand region
или наличие лишних пробелов вокруг формы...
в общем, при копировании чистых (и правильно отформатированных) форм без мусора работает без проблем, а в остальных случаях лотерея
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Sergey Trofimov
при копипасте стреляет в зависимости от того, как выровнен вставляемый код 😊
я вообще только из-за паринфера научился код не строками копировать, а формами, выделяя из через expand region
Хороший плагин в емаксе при выделении-вставке обрезает лишние пробелы и балансирует скобки
источник

AC

Anton Chikin in Clojure — русскоговорящее сообщество
Т.е. при вставке у тебя вокруг точно не взорвется ничего
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
да даже из репла вставить ctrl-v или ctrl-alt-v в первом случае результат неправильный
источник

ST

Sergey Trofimov in Clojure — русскоговорящее сообщество
Anton Chikin
Хороший плагин в емаксе при выделении-вставке обрезает лишние пробелы и балансирует скобки
то есть копирует по факту не то, что я выделил (и вижу), если я скопировал несбалансированный код?
ну такое тоже может доставить сюрприз
источник

N

Nikolay in Clojure — русскоговорящее сообщество
Подскажите, что можно взять в качестве бд для кложи, на первых проектах
источник

PP

Pavel Peganov in Clojure — русскоговорящее сообщество
Nikolay
Подскажите, что можно взять в качестве бд для кложи, на первых проектах
Есть мнение, что БД нужно подбирать под задачу/проект, а не под язык 🤔
Адаптеры есть практически под любую БД, хотя бы и для Java.
источник

N

Nikolay in Clojure — русскоговорящее сообщество
Pavel Peganov
Есть мнение, что БД нужно подбирать под задачу/проект, а не под язык 🤔
Адаптеры есть практически под любую БД, хотя бы и для Java.
Ну есть же самые распространенные варианты?
источник

N

Nikolay in Clojure — русскоговорящее сообщество
На ноде я бы взял монго и все
источник